Output 951c3cc675e69bc6316d6f430d1187b9762e11c8f0e953455802389ee613a934:0

value
21664212
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 666cbd0dbce46623cf100c6d13a9262814f14e8e OP_EQUALVERIFY OP_CHECKSIG
address
1ALaBrGiyGQ7MM8JnzmBNZNJHUDFgBYRkd
transaction
951c3cc675e69bc6316d6f430d1187b9762e11c8f0e953455802389ee613a934
spent
true